Main features and details

The process of fast casino withdrawals typically involves several stages. Initially, players must select their preferred withdrawal method. E-wallets like P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ill are popular choices due to their speed, often allowing transactions to be completed within hours. In contrast, traditional bank transfers may take several days, depending on the bank’s processing times. Additionally, casinos may impose withdrawal limits, which can affect how quickly players can access their funds.

Another crucial aspect is the verification process. Most reputable online casinos require players to verify their identity before processing withdrawals. This step is essential for preventing fraud and ensuring compliance with Australian gambling regulations. Players should prepare necessary documents, such as identification and proof of address, to expedite this process.

  • Withdrawal Methods: E-wallets, credit/debit cards, bank transfers, cryptocurrencies.
  • Processing Times: Ranges from instant to several days based on method.
  • Verification: Required for security and regulatory compliance.

Additional insights

Players should be aware of edge cases that may impact withdrawal times. For instance, if a player has not completed the verification process, their withdrawal request may be put on hold until all necessary documentation is provided. Additionally, casinos may have specific terms and conditions regarding withdrawal limits and processing times that players should review before engaging in play.

Expert tips for ensuring fast withdrawals include selecting casinos known for their efficient payout processes, regularly updating personal information to avoid verification delays, and opting for e-wallets or cryptocurrencies when possible.
